New Delhi: Australian cricket team all-rounder Mitchell Marsh has decided to withdraw from the ICC World Cup 2023 due to personal reasons.
His departure has led to his return to Australia from India during this major cricket event, and the likelihood of his return to the tournament appears to be minimal.
Additionally, Glenn Maxwell will be unable to participate in the upcoming match against England due to certain constraints.
The inclusion of a replacement player in the Australian squad will necessitate approval from the Technical Committee.
